Lyndon is an Audit Partner in Vancouver servicing public and private companies in real estate, technology, tourism and manufacturing sectors. As a member of KPMG’s Asia Pacific Group, Lyndon brings tremendous international perspectives and connections from his experience working in Vancouver, China and Toronto. He spent seven years in China where he was the Canadian firm’s representative based in Beijing. During his time in Beijing, he was involved in cross-border transactions facilitating investments into Canada from China and investments into China from European countries and PE funds. Professional and Industry Experience – Asia Pacific Practice 

  • Injection of Canadian private company valued at $730 million into a public company in Asia – audit. 
  • Acquisition of Canadian technology company valued at $70 million by Chinese public company. 
  • Real estate investments (direct and joint venture) in Vancouver from investors based in China. 
  • Assisted companies in IPO listing and worked on projects to streamline Company’s financial reporting and operational processes.
